Can you see the frequencies of each sound represented in space?

This is an imagining of one possible metaverse where all music has a life of its own in a synesthesia world. Purple lines fade to blue and recedes as each harmonic fades. The height of each harmonic represents the amplitude. Lower frequencies are on the left. As far as I know it is not possible to show a full colour stereoscopic 3D 4K video on Vimeo. TECHNICAL DESCRIPTION

Made with care in derivative Touch Designer, using my VR180 framework program. The background galaxy is a skybox purchased from the Unity store. The foreground code is based on Ab-out's brilliant "2022 Audio Histogram" tutorial, with thanks. This is rendered real time at 60 frames per second from a fast fourier transform analysis of the music. Many thanks for watching.
